At present I don't have a radio that chirp talks to so I'm unable to 
test further, but 'chirp-latest' appears to be functional on my 
Raspberry Pi 4 following the info in this thread. 73 Mike G8NXD.

====

$ sudo apt install git python3-wxgtk4.0 python3-serial python3-six 
python3-future python3-requests python3-pip

Then grab the tarball and run "pip install" on the tarball

If you ran the above as your own user, then ~/.local/bin is where they are.
If you ran it as root, it should put it in /usr/local/bin.
